The 2nd annual “World Snow Day” has held at Roppongi Hills in Tokyo. It was the first launch out World Snow Day's event at Tokyo Japan in 2013 over the world, and more than 30,000 participants visited Roppongi over the weekend.

The event was held over a two day period. At the center of the event a huge 'hip' was constructed on which a Big Air/ Freestyle demonstration was staged. In keeping with the theme of 'children' well known athletes between the ages of 9-15 years of age from the USA, Korea and Japan took part in the demonstration. The use of people form the targeted age group excited the children and families more as those athletes will be participating in the Winter Olympic Games in South Korea 2018!

To further engage and interact the crowd, presented big events at [National Sports Festival Tokyo2013] booth and [2014 Sochi Winter Olympic games] booth, children had the opportunity to enjoy the snow in specially established play area. Snow games, sledges and snow flag races on the 60-degree hip jump landing area were some of the great activities children could participate in.

The event not only brought children to snow sports but also created a great environment for families to be together., We hope that kids who played with the snow at World Snow Day will one day come to the snowy mountain to enjoy winter sports.
